Farnham Antique Carpets Ltd
Farnham Antique Carpets Ltd
Spencer Swaffer Antiques Ltd
Farnham Antique Carpets Ltd
Legge Carpets Ltd
C John (Rare Rugs) Ltd
Farnham Antique Carpets Ltd
Farnham Antique Carpets Ltd
Gallery Yacou
Farnham Antique Carpets Ltd